Inpatient hospitalization programs in Point Pleasant are a form of drug rehab program which provides rehabilitation in a hospital or similar setting where the rehabilitation process can be managed by medical staff and addiction professionals. As is frequently the case with alcohol and benzodiazepine withdrawal, it is sometimes necessary for the person to be in an inpatient hospitalization program during the withdrawal process because some withdrawal symptoms can be life threatening. Inpatient hospitalization programs are also an option for those in Point Pleasant who wish to undergo medication assisted withdrawal, which is typically used in the case of prescription pain reliever and illicit opiate addiction. Most people in Point Pleasant, Pennsylvania who choose this treatment route however and don't follow up with further intensive treatment have extremely high rates of relapse. In either case, individuals should follow up the detox process with an intensive treatment program either in inpatient hospitalization or in some other drug rehab center.
